India, Oct. 24 -- Death marks a sharply drawn line between just another day and That Day. For those bereaved, death becomes the demarcation between many a before and after. Whether it lands like a sudden slap on the face or slowly drips into your days, leaving you in a quagmire of uncertainty - death and complex emotions are inseparable in the living. It is, therefore, difficult to imagine people gathering in large numbers to be part of a "Death Literacy Festival" called Good.To.Go.

Organized by Pallium India and Vidhi Centre for Legal Policy, 'Good.To.Go. Death Literacy Festival' was a festival no less - complete with music, poetry, grief circles, panel discussions, workshops and installations. The festival encouraged people to express ...
